Introduction to Telecom Filters

Telecom filters play a crucial role in the telecommunications industry by ensuring signal integrity and reducing unwanted interference. They are designed to allow certain frequencies of signals to pass while blocking others, ensuring that communication systems operate efficiently and effectively. From phones to data transmission networks, telecom filters are indispensable to maintain the quality and reliability of communication methods.

Types of Telecom Filters

Telecom filters are classified based on their functionality, architecture, and application. Here are the main types:

  • Low-pass Filters: These filters allow frequencies below a certain threshold to pass while attenuating higher frequencies. They are commonly used in audio devices and RF systems.
  • High-pass Filters: Opposite to low-pass, these filters enable frequencies above a specific cutoff to pass through, blocking lower frequencies. They are critical for applications that need to eliminate low-frequency noise.
  • Band-pass Filters: These filters allow a particular range of frequencies to pass while inhibiting others, making them effective in communication systems that require precise frequency selection.
  • Band-stop Filters: Also known as notch filters, these block a specific frequency range, which can help eliminate interference from nearby signals.

Applications of Telecom Filters

Telecom filters are used in a variety of applications across multiple industries to enhance signal quality. Key applications include:

  • Mobile Communication: Ensuring clarity in voice and data transmission by filtering out irrelevant frequency signals.
  • Satellite Communication: Essential in satellite transmitting systems to prevent interference and ensure a clear signal.
  • Broadcasting: Used in both AM and FM broadcasting to manage the quality of audio signals as well as minimize noise.
  • Networking Equipment: Telecom filters are widely employed in routers and switches to maintain optimal data transfer rates and prevent data packet loss.
